The artistic level of the printing design of publications in Czech was generally not very high.

They were primarily intended for readers from the lower level of Czech society. Nigrin printed many copies, which were cheap. “History of Tamerlane” is one of such publications targeted on broad public.

Through a combination of fictional storytelling and professional interpretation of historical facts, the book introduced Czech burghers to the story of Amir Timur, an eminent medieval eastern statesman and commander. In addition, the content of this book was close to the anti-Turkish theme popular in the European literature at that time. Fierce battles and other events described in the book aroused great interest in readers.
